diff options
| author | 2018-01-04 00:45:55 +0000 | |
|---|---|---|
| committer | 2018-01-04 00:45:55 +0000 | |
| commit | 478b6caa48ee001aa9273e36efe1b754dca87d7e (patch) | |
| tree | ef94ad32d40a0e8408be68a91907437d71117cab | |
| parent | 9661f209d5fa930d0668c1d80e9ba7632319c19d (diff) | |
| parent | 57e77f7c1370a563d130586c978c4870e6a78193 (diff) | |
Merge "Fix some nits while reading the code"
4 files changed, 7 insertions, 4 deletions
diff --git a/core/java/android/security/recoverablekeystore/RecoverableKeyStoreLoader.java b/core/java/android/security/recoverablekeystore/RecoverableKeyStoreLoader.java index 72a138a629cf..0cf8da5b3a86 100644 --- a/core/java/android/security/recoverablekeystore/RecoverableKeyStoreLoader.java +++ b/core/java/android/security/recoverablekeystore/RecoverableKeyStoreLoader.java @@ -426,7 +426,7 @@ public class RecoverableKeyStoreLoader { * Imports keys. * * @param sessionId Id for recovery session, same as in - * {@link #startRecoverySession(String, byte[], byte[], byte[], List)} on}. + * {@link #startRecoverySession(String, byte[], byte[], byte[], List)}. * @param recoveryKeyBlob Recovery blob encrypted by symmetric key generated for this session. * @param applicationKeys Application keys. Key material can be decrypted using recoveryKeyBlob * and session. KeyStore only uses package names from the application info in {@link diff --git a/services/core/java/com/android/server/locksettings/LockSettingsService.java b/services/core/java/com/android/server/locksettings/LockSettingsService.java index 482acefac3a5..02218ffc14ea 100644 --- a/services/core/java/com/android/server/locksettings/LockSettingsService.java +++ b/services/core/java/com/android/server/locksettings/LockSettingsService.java @@ -2026,8 +2026,9 @@ public class LockSettingsService extends ILockSettings.Stub { } @Override - public Map<String, byte[]> recoverKeys(@NonNull String sessionId, @NonNull byte[] recoveryKeyBlob, - @NonNull List<KeyEntryRecoveryData> applicationKeys, @UserIdInt int userId) + public Map<String, byte[]> recoverKeys(@NonNull String sessionId, + @NonNull byte[] recoveryKeyBlob, @NonNull List<KeyEntryRecoveryData> applicationKeys, + @UserIdInt int userId) throws RemoteException { return mRecoverableKeyStoreManager.recoverKeys( sessionId, recoveryKeyBlob, applicationKeys, userId); diff --git a/services/core/java/com/android/server/locksettings/recoverablekeystore/PlatformKeyManager.java b/services/core/java/com/android/server/locksettings/recoverablekeystore/PlatformKeyManager.java index 1719710e5fe6..ef4dbf57430f 100644 --- a/services/core/java/com/android/server/locksettings/recoverablekeystore/PlatformKeyManager.java +++ b/services/core/java/com/android/server/locksettings/recoverablekeystore/PlatformKeyManager.java @@ -88,7 +88,8 @@ public class PlatformKeyManager { * * @hide */ - public static PlatformKeyManager getInstance(Context context, RecoverableKeyStoreDb database, int userId) + public static PlatformKeyManager getInstance(Context context, RecoverableKeyStoreDb database, + int userId) throws KeyStoreException, NoSuchAlgorithmException, InsecureUserException { context = context.getApplicationContext(); PlatformKeyManager keyManager = new PlatformKeyManager( diff --git a/services/core/java/com/android/server/locksettings/recoverablekeystore/storage/RecoverableKeyStoreDb.java b/services/core/java/com/android/server/locksettings/recoverablekeystore/storage/RecoverableKeyStoreDb.java index 838311e185e8..5ca5da4ead56 100644 --- a/services/core/java/com/android/server/locksettings/recoverablekeystore/storage/RecoverableKeyStoreDb.java +++ b/services/core/java/com/android/server/locksettings/recoverablekeystore/storage/RecoverableKeyStoreDb.java @@ -590,6 +590,7 @@ public class RecoverableKeyStoreDb { * * @hide */ + @Nullable public Long getServerParameters(int userId, int uid) { SQLiteDatabase db = mKeyStoreDbHelper.getReadableDatabase(); |